    U.S. Embassy Empowers Sri Lanka with Concessions Training to Boost Transparent and Sustainable Port Infrastructure

    The U.S. Embassy in Sri Lanka has recently conducted a specialized training program focused on the Ports Law, aimed at enhancing the country’s capacity to implement transparent and sustainable infrastructure practices. This initiative underscores the Embassy’s commitment to supporting Sri Lanka’s development priorities by promoting sound governance and responsible investment in its vital port sector. By equipping local officials and stakeholders with comprehensive knowledge on concessions and legal frameworks, the training seeks to strengthen institutional transparency and foster long-term economic growth.

    Strengthening Bonds: U.S. Indo-Pacific Commander’s Visit to Sri Lanka

    In a meaningful effort to strengthen regional security and diplomatic relations, the U.S. Indo-Pacific Commander has recently visited Sri Lanka,highlighting the United States’ dedication to building partnerships in the strategically vital Indian Ocean area. This visit occurs against a backdrop of rising geopolitical tensions and economic difficulties faced by countries in the region, sparking discussions on collaborative defense, trade, and maritime security initiatives. As part of a extensive strategy aimed at reinforcing alliances with key nations, the U.S. Indo-Pacific Command is committed to ensuring stability and promoting shared values among countries in this crucial part of the world. This article explores the implications of this Commander’s visit, areas for potential cooperation discussed during meetings, and what it signifies for Sri Lanka’s position within the Indo-Pacific framework.
